Latest Patents

Zachary's latest patents showcase his expertise in shock absorber technology. The first patent, titled "Damper with Integrated Electronics," presents a bumper cap assembly for an electrically adjustable hydraulic shock absorber. This innovative design incorporates a printed circuit board assembly that contains power drive electronics, which are electrically coupled to the shock absorber. This assembly is cleverly housed within a defined gap in the bumper cap, enhancing both functionality and compactness.

The second patent, "Low Pressure High Compression Damping Monotube Shock Absorber," introduces a monotube shock absorber capable of delivering high compression damping forces at low pressure, thereby reducing friction. This invention includes essential components such as a pressure tube, a piston assembly, a piston rod, a fixed valve assembly, and a floating piston. Furthermore, it outlines various methods for securing the fixed valve assembly to the pressure tube, including single-piece pressure tubes and assembly techniques for oil filling.
